Transaction 34439f31df58ef910e7dbd33f3ef0fefce076bf3dcbf8608fe3f3b26561e251e
1 Input
1 Output
-
34439f31df58ef910e7dbd33f3ef0fefce076bf3dcbf8608fe3f3b26561e251e:0
- value
- 409039
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f3146d1e9c4d41a4c2b73781bd2b82a9eedb2b8 OP_EQUAL
- address
- 3K7x1z3gB1a7MdQM174gRfUkA2gU8GBicq